The Advanced Skill Certificate in Crustacean Mussel Physiology offers a comprehensive study of the physiological characteristics and behaviors of crustaceans and mussels. Throughout this program, students will delve into topics such as osmoregulation, feeding mechanisms, and reproductive strategies in these aquatic organisms. By the end of the course, participants will have a deep understanding of the physiological adaptations that allow crustaceans and mussels to thrive in their environments.
